Math Vocabulary | ||
#1 | What is the product of a specific number and any other number? | Multiple |
#2 | When you multiply two numbers, the answer is called the ______? | Product |
#3 | What does LCM stand for? | Least Common Multiple |
#4 | Multiples that are shared by two or more numbers? LEAST COMMON or COMMON MULTIPLES? | Common Multiples |
#5 | What is it called when two fractions are equal? | Equivalent Fractions |
